BELL X1

Blue Lights on the Runway

2009-04-13

Bell X1, named after the first supersonic airplane, is an Irish band. They were originally known as Juniper and included Damien Rice as a member. This is their fourth studio album and their sound has changed a bit since Mr. Rice's leaving. Their sound has been compared to that of Talking Heads. I don't buy the comparison, unless you are talking about the track, "The Great Defector". As the lead single from the album, it offers a lot of similarities, right down to the David Byrne-sounding vocals of Paul Noonan. Otherwise, this is electronic-infused pop with the best songs being the upbeat "A Better Band" and "Breastfed". "Amelia" is a good one as well, it being about none other than Amelia Earhart. The liner notes mention the ballad, "Light Catches Your Face", as a focus track that was once featured on a television show called One Tree Hill. Reviewed by Rebecca Ruth.
